the world > time > a suitable time or opportunity > untimeliness > delay or postponement > delay [verb (intransitive)] > be delayed (9)
hang1494

To remain unsettled or unfinished; to be held in process or in abeyance: often with a notion of delay. See also hanging, adj. 3. Obsolete.

stick?a1518

intransitive. Of a matter: to come to a standstill, to suffer delay or hindrance, to fail to progress. Chiefly with adverb or prepositional phrase…

supersede1569

Scottish. intransitive. To be postponed. Obsolete. rare.

to cool one's heels (also feet, hooves)1576

to cool one's heels (also †feet, †hooves): to rest, esp. after the feet have become hot with walking; (now usually) to wait, to be kept waiting.

slow1601

intransitive. To be delayed or deferred. Obsolete. rare.

stay1642

Of a business or other matter: To be deferred or postponed for a season; to be kept waiting, be allowed to wait. Obsolete.

retard1646

intransitive. To slow down; spec. to undergo retardation (retardation, n. 2a).
